photoshop
people often ask me what kind of camera i have. i have a canon 20D and a 50D.
although your camera is important, your editing software is just as important. when i first got photoshop, my instructor told me it would take a couple years to master it. this is true! photoshop is a never-ending learning experience for me. this image shows the importance and difference in results after editing.
so while camera choice is important, you don't just get great shots straight out of the camera... ok, well, that IS the goal! i am working on that as well BUT the point is your camera and editing go hand in hand.
